Solution for p^4-8p^2+3=0 equation:


Simplifying
p4 + -8p2 + 3 = 0

Reorder the terms:
3 + -8p2 + p4 = 0

Solving
3 + -8p2 + p4 = 0

Solving for variable 'p'.

Begin completing the square.

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-8p2 + -3 + p4 = 0 + -3

Reorder the terms:
3 + -3 + -8p2 + p4 = 0 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+ -8p2 + p4 = 0 + -3
-8p2 + p4 = 0 + -3

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3
-8p2 + p4 = -3

The p term is -8p2.  Take half its coefficient (-4).
Square it (16) and add it to both sides.

Add '16' to each side of the equation.
-8p2 + 16 + p4 = -3 + 16

Reorder the terms:
16 + -8p2 + p4 = -3 + 16

Combine like terms: -3 + 16 = 13
16 + -8p2 + p4 = 13

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(p2 + -4)(p2 + -4) = 13

Calculate the square root of the right side: 3.605551275

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(p2 + -4) equal to 3.605551275 and -3.605551275.

Subproblem 1

p2 + -4 = 3.605551275 Simplifying p2 + -4 = 3.605551275 Reorder the terms: -4 + p2 = 3.605551275 Solving -4 + p2 = 3.605551275 Solving for variable 'p'.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'4' to each side of the equation. -4 + 4 + p2 = 3.605551275 + 4 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0 0 + p2 = 3.605551275 + 4 p2 = 3.605551275 + 4 Combine like terms: 3.605551275 + 4 = 7.605551275 p2 = 7.605551275 Simplifying p2 = 7.605551275 Take the square root of each side: p = {-2.757816396, 2.757816396}

Subproblem 2

p2 + -4 = -3.605551275 Simplifying p2 + -4 = -3.605551275 Reorder the terms: -4 + p2 = -3.605551275 Solving -4 + p2 = -3.605551275 Solving for variable 'p'.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'4' to each side of the equation. -4 + 4 + p2 = -3.605551275 + 4 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0 0 + p2 = -3.605551275 + 4 p2 = -3.605551275 + 4 Combine like terms: -3.605551275 + 4 = 0.394448725 p2 = 0.394448725 Simplifying p2 = 0.394448725 Take the square root of each side: p = {-0.628051531, 0.628051531}

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. p = {-2.757816396, 2.757816396, -0.628051531, 0.628051531}
